School of Public Health and Community MedicineAbout Axel Andersson
Medical Doctor, now PhD student in Medicine at Occupational and Environmental Medicine, Sahlgrenska Academy. My studies are predominately about the elimination of Perfloroalkyl substances (PFAS) in humans, but I also have some involvment into health effect studies of PFAS.
My everyday tasks consist mainly of study design, statistics and epidemiology. I teach epidemiology to medical students at Sahlgrenska Academy.
